Step Into Your Next Chapter Manage and coordinate the delivery of high-quality advice and support provided by the Special Education Program and/or Early Childhood Development Program. Lead and manage the Special Education Program and/or Early Childhood Development Program to provide advice to classroom teachers for students with disability as needed. Provide high quality advice to the school leadership team, classroom teachers and other school staff to develop, plan and implement effective reasonable adjustments for students with disability. Coordinate and provide intensive targeted teaching for students requiring intervention. Provide, support and/or coordinate case management for students who require extensive or substantial adjustments. Please view the role description for a full list of responsibilities.
